A novel and significant method was developed and validated with a sensitive, rapid, and simultaneous analytical method to determine antimicrobials in chicken tissues such as the kidney and liver. The process involved a unique approach to precipitation extraction. This method has not been widely used in this context,
followed by the evaporation of the supernatant and reconstitution with the mobile phase. Antimicrobials, including Azithromycin, Clarithromycin, Erythromycin, Clavulanic acid, Ciprofloxacin, Clofazimine, Fluconazole, Linezolid, and Moxifloxacin were meticulously considered for development and validation in the chicken tissues. These antimicrobials were chosen based on their everyday use in poultry farming and their potential impact on human health. We used Ultra-Performance Liquid Chromatography with triple quad Mass Spectrometry and employed multiple reaction monitoring to detect the analytes of interest. All the compounds were well separated using Atlantis T3, 4.6x50mm, 3 μm. The linear range was set between 25 to 1000 ng/gm. The method was validated following linearity, extraction recovery, matrix effect impact, limit of detection, sensitivity, autosampler and benchtop stability, ensuring the results’ reliability and our method’s robustness.
